Frank Avellino is the former mayor of New York City and has two daughters, Alexandra and Sofia and on this night one of them has murdered him. They both call 911 at about the same time and say the other one did it and both are arrested. Lawyer Eddie Flynn is given a tip about this and ends up signing Sophia as his client. She has convinced him she’s innocent and her sister did it. We end up going to trial and watching the case play out. Along the way one of the sisters writes about her plans, why she killed her dad and how she is killing potential witnesses that could implicate her. Then we get the verdict and shocking reveal. This is another great Eddie Flynn novel that keeps you guessing throughout. The story rotates each chapter from different characters’ perspectives, which enhances the novel. This is the fifth book in the series and they keep getting better and better.
